Selectmen vote to hire Bouchell
By Caitlyn Kelleher

Paul Bouchell
On Monday, June 11, selectmen voted unanimously to appoint Paul Bouchell as the interim town administrator while Town Administrator Kevin Paicos is deployed with the Army National Guard.

Bouchell was one of the two finalists interviewed for the position, that is expected to last about a year, on Monday, June 4. The board also interviewed Dana Keenan, the interim town administrator in Webster.

Selectman Christopher Gagnon said both candidates had excellent resumes and experience.

"My decision came down to familiarity with the town of Ashburnham," he said.

Selectmen Jonathan Dennehy and Mark Carlisle agreed with Gagnon's assessment. Bouchell has served as the town's interim town administrator twice (both were month long engagements) while Paicos has been assigned to training missions.

Bouchell has also worked on a variety of consulting projects for the town.

"We've worked successfully with Paul for the last month while Kevin was on training," Dennehy said.

The selectmen and Bouchell will have to negotiate a contract but all parties hope to do that as soon as possible. Bouchell is still working for the town under the terms of the contract he served under during Paicos's last training assignment.
